Lately, it seems like I keep running into trouble I've never seen before! This time it happened when I went in to go whack the Don. I never seem to remember what the appropriate level is to do this and I recall one time that I literally had to wait till he ran completely out of stamina and went unconscious before I could hit him at all! So I've gotten lazy in my last few games and just had a couple canned elementals do the deed for me... But this time it didn't work because any elementals, either canned or cast by my bishop immediately went hostile on me with no explanation, and this happened regardless of the number of times I reloaded. I hope this isn't a sign that my elementals will hate me everywhere I cast them in the game!!! LOL! Anyway, I finally gave up on the elementals and just used some superman potions, and the Don was dead in four easy rounds. Probably just a case of bad karma, but does anyone else have pissed off elementals?

One condition under which it can happen easily is surprise combat. If you start the fight while everyone around is green, the game will automatically include all the greens as hostile.
In other words: You enter, and the Don and Milano are green. You initiate combat, and start right away with making elementals and buffs. The Elementals form before you've done anything to the Don or Milano, so everyone is green. Once you start hitting the Don or Milano, the elementals join them in turning hostile, because they are, after all, monsters, and assume you've turned against alla the greenies. You gotta do something to make the intended foe turn red before the elementals form, so they can tell the difference. |
